What is the Colorado Drive Time Log Sheet?

The Colorado Drive Time Log Sheet is an essential document for student drivers under 18 years old, designed to log their driving experiences in Colorado. This log sheet serves the important purpose of ensuring that young drivers complete a minimum of 50 hours of supervised driving, including at least 10 hours of night driving. It is necessary for students to accurately record their driving time, providing a comprehensive account that is essential for taking the next steps toward obtaining a driver's license.

The Colorado Drive Time Log Sheet must be signed by a parent or guardian, or by a driver education instructor. Their signature verifies the accuracy of the logged driving hours.
This form must be used by student drivers under 18 in Colorado who are preparing to apply for a driver’s license. They must complete the required 50 hours of driving, including 10 hours at night.
The completed Colorado Drive Time Log Sheet must be submitted along with your driver’s license application. Ensure you follow submission guidelines provided by your local licensing authority.
You will need your student’s name, permit number, total driving hours, night driving hours, and initials from the parent/guardian or instructor. Make sure to gather this information before starting the form.
No, the Colorado Drive Time Log Sheet does not require notarization. However, it must be signed by a qualified person before submission.
